Uncategorized

No products were found matching your selection.

YOU MIGHT ALSO LIKE

Omega Square 9k 3115490

Omega Square 9k 3115490

REF W6030 / PRICE £2,895

Add to cart
IWC Schaffhausen Oman Khanjar

IWC Schaffhausen Oman Khanjar

REF W4308 / PRICE £9,695

Add to cart
Tag Heuer 1000 980.013B

Tag Heuer 1000 980.013B

REF w5906a / PRICE £795

Add to cart